Summary

Postman has evolved from a simple REST client to a comprehensive API platform, balancing robust functionality with user-friendly design by implementing relational interfaces. A key feature in this evolution is the introduction of panes, which function as customizable views into data, allowing users to resize, expand, or collapse them to fit their needs. This flexibility is enhanced by the concept of concurrency, enabling users to execute different parts of a task in any order without affecting the final outcome, thereby increasing efficiency. To avoid complexity, Postman ensures that each pane has a distinct purpose and relationship with neighboring panes, as demonstrated by features like the integrated Postman Console and context bars for comments. The latest release allows users to interact with panes during request and response processes, with future developments exploring further customization options. Feedback from the community is crucial as Postman continues to refine and expand its platform capabilities.
